Transaction 580eded27e45615c3b3be8163dab049bff6f152459b28dac95a7904536d2286d

1 Input
2 Outputs
  • 580eded27e45615c3b3be8163dab049bff6f152459b28dac95a7904536d2286d:0
  • value  342983
    address  392knYJ95f5dwSGeFAn7VuDtQSHimpGm9U
  • 580eded27e45615c3b3be8163dab049bff6f152459b28dac95a7904536d2286d:1
  • value  10422012
    address  3MJkmh7zmdft92MsWBWjX9G9VDdJU8h2ma